Transaction 8ab14d91537d81c14f5102094c377f47935880dfb7cae5a1030cf00d7be7e48f
1 Input
1 Output
-
8ab14d91537d81c14f5102094c377f47935880dfb7cae5a1030cf00d7be7e48f:0
- value
- 152411
- script pubkey
- OP_0 OP_PUSHBYTES_20 252eb687d3b647af2016d91347a269f2bc912008
- address
- bc1qy5htdp7nker67gqkmyf50gnf727fzgqguxptja